Modern mantra music performed in Rockport, April 28

Event has passed

    ROCKPORT — Musical duo Darshan Music is bringing their harmonious chants and drumbeats to Rockport on Sunday, April 28. Darshan Music’s take on the ancient practice of kirtan – simple call-and-response mantras to music – offers participants the benefits of yoga or meditation.

    Since they combined forces in 2017, Darshan Music members Carla Renzi (drums) and Justin Maseychik (harmonium) have been performing their modern interpretation of this genre of Bangla song at yoga studios, indoor and outdoor venues across the country. They regularly perform in Belfast, Rockport and Damariscotta, and are scheduled to play at Coastal Mountain Land Trust’s Arts on the Hill this summer.
